The Tampa Bay Rays made a move this week that came out of left field. Very few MLB insiders had them linked to a former All-Star and longtime member of the Baltimore Orioles. In any event, Cedric Mullins is headed to the Rays on a one-year, $7 million deal. Mullins is a player who isn’t a strict platoon option and has plenty of veteran experience.
